How to Catch Toilet Fish in Fisch

A Fisch player has caught a Toilet Fish
Screenshot by Destructoid

You can catch a Toilet Fish by fishing in the Open Ocean in the Second Sea. Despite being a Secret Fish, we were able to catch one in about 10 minutes. We used the Free Spirit Rod with Instant Catcher as bait, but if you want to maximize your chances, you can also use a rod with a lower maximum weight, such as the Training Rod and Weird Algae.

Even though it’s a reference to Skibidi Toilet, there’s really nothing special about this secret fish, other than being a gag. It’s not difficult to catch, it’s not worth much, it’s just a fish in a toilet.

How to Catch a Sea Leviathan in Fisch

A Fisch player is trying to catch a Sea Leviathan
Screenshot by Destructoid

You can catch a Sea Leviathan in the Second Sea when it’s spawned and only if you are fishing in its area. Unlike many Exotic Fish we’ve seen in the First Sea, the Sea Leviathan is annoyingly different. Even though you can make one spawn by spamming Tempest and Smokescreen Totems only at night, you won’t get a notification that a Sea Leviathan has spawned. Instead, you have to go out and look for one.

Sea Leviathans can swim around the Second Sea, usually around the edges of the map (around Lushgrove), and you literally need to roam around and hope you find ꧅them during Rainy or Foggy weather.

One thing that may help in your search is floating purple boxes. If you see them out in the Second Sea (they do stand out), you’ll know there’s a Sea Leviathan somewhere. It has a -90% Speed Progress, and your enchantments won’t work, so make sure you use a rod with high Resilience.

How to catch Tartaruga in Fisch

A Fisch player is holding a Tartaruga
Screenshot by Destructoid

If you’re after the best fish for grinding XP in the Second Sea, then you’re not looking for a fish at all, but a Turtle. Tartarugas are currently the best source of XP in the Second Sea. You can read more about this in our Best Second Sea XP and Farming Locations in Fisch.

You can catch a Tartaruga on the Isle of New Beginnings. Tartarugas are somewhat rare, but you should be able to catch a few with even the worst rod. Still, to improve your chances, we recommend you use a Free Spirit Rod with an Instant Catcher. 🍷If you have rarer bait, like Luminous Larva or Golden 💟Worms, they are great picks too.
